DBA Data[Home] [Help]

APPS.IGS_UC_EXPORT_HESA_TO_OSS_PKG dependencies on IGS_AD_INTERFACE

Line 96: l_interface_run_id igs_ad_interface_ctl.interface_run_id%TYPE;

92: FROM igs_pe_match_sets
93: WHERE source_type_id = p_source_type_id;
94: match_set_rec cur_match_set%ROWTYPE;
95:
96: l_interface_run_id igs_ad_interface_ctl.interface_run_id%TYPE;
97: l_errbuff VARCHAR2(100) ;
98: l_retcode NUMBER ;
99:
100: BEGIN

Line 268: SELECT igs_ad_interface_batch_id_s.NEXTVAL

264: WHERE person_id = p_per_id;
265:
266: -- Get the Batch ID for admission application import process
267: CURSOR c_bat_id IS
268: SELECT igs_ad_interface_batch_id_s.NEXTVAL
269: FROM dual;
270:
271: -- Get the Person number for the passed person id.
272: CURSOR c_person_info (cp_person_id igs_pe_person_base_v.person_id%TYPE) IS

Line 279: CURSOR c_adm_int( cp_batch_id igs_ad_interface.batch_id%TYPE) IS

275: WHERE person_id = cp_person_id;
276: l_person_info_rec c_person_info%ROWTYPE;
277:
278: -- Get the admission application instance interface records whose import has failed
279: CURSOR c_adm_int( cp_batch_id igs_ad_interface.batch_id%TYPE) IS
280: SELECT a.person_number, a.interface_id
281: FROM igs_ad_interface a
282: WHERE a.batch_id = cp_batch_id
283: AND ( a.status IN ('2','3') OR a.record_status='3' ) ;

Line 281: FROM igs_ad_interface a

277:
278: -- Get the admission application instance interface records whose import has failed
279: CURSOR c_adm_int( cp_batch_id igs_ad_interface.batch_id%TYPE) IS
280: SELECT a.person_number, a.interface_id
281: FROM igs_ad_interface a
282: WHERE a.batch_id = cp_batch_id
283: AND ( a.status IN ('2','3') OR a.record_status='3' ) ;
284:
285: -- to fetch the system code in the order U,S,N,G in case there are multiple ethnic data

Line 301: l_imp_batch_id igs_ad_interface_all.batch_id%TYPE ;

297: WHERE a.interface_id = cp_interface_id
298: AND a.status = '3';
299: l_interface_stat_rec c_stat_int%ROWTYPE ;
300:
301: l_imp_batch_id igs_ad_interface_all.batch_id%TYPE ;
302: l_interface_id igs_ad_interface_all.interface_id%TYPE ;
303: l_interface_stat_id igs_ad_stat_int_all.interface_stat_id%TYPE;
304: l_chk_per_present VARCHAR2(1) := 'Y';
305: l_col_ad_null VARCHAR2(1) := 'Y';

Line 302: l_interface_id igs_ad_interface_all.interface_id%TYPE ;

298: AND a.status = '3';
299: l_interface_stat_rec c_stat_int%ROWTYPE ;
300:
301: l_imp_batch_id igs_ad_interface_all.batch_id%TYPE ;
302: l_interface_id igs_ad_interface_all.interface_id%TYPE ;
303: l_interface_stat_id igs_ad_stat_int_all.interface_stat_id%TYPE;
304: l_chk_per_present VARCHAR2(1) := 'Y';
305: l_col_ad_null VARCHAR2(1) := 'Y';
306: l_col_spa_null VARCHAR2(1) := 'Y';

Line 664: INSERT INTO igs_ad_interface(person_number,

660:
661: IF l_interface_id IS NULL THEN
662:
663:
664: INSERT INTO igs_ad_interface(person_number,
665: interface_id,
666: batch_id,
667: source_type_id,
668: person_id,

Line 686: igs_ad_interface_s.NEXTVAL,

682: program_application_id,
683: program_update_date,
684: program_id)
685: VALUES(l_person_info_rec.person_number,
686: igs_ad_interface_s.NEXTVAL,
687: l_imp_batch_id,
688: l_src_type_id_rec.source_type_id,
689: all_appl_rec.oss_person_id,
690: l_person_info_rec.surname,